Preparation time: 30 minutes
Baking time: 30 minutes
Total time: 1 hour
Number of servings: 12
Ingredients
For the base:
- 6 eggs
- 6 tablespoons of sugar
- 6 tablespoons of flour
- 1 teaspoon of baking powder
- Oil for greasing the pan
- Flour for dusting the pan
For the cream:
- 300 ml milk
- 4 tablespoons of sugar
- 1 packet of caramel pudding
- 1 packet (250 g) of margarine (like Rama), left at room temperature
- 150 g ground walnuts
- 100 g chocolate (for decoration)

Preparing the Base
1. Separating the eggs: Start by separating the egg whites from the yolks. It is important for the eggs to be fresh, as they contribute to the fluffiness of the base.
2. Beating the egg whites: In a large bowl, beat the egg whites with 6 tablespoons of sugar using a high-speed mixer. Continue beating until you obtain a firm and shiny foam. This step is crucial for achieving a light and airy base.
3. Yolks: In another bowl, cream the yolks until they become creamy. Add them over the egg white foam, gently folding with a spatula to avoid losing air from the mixture.
4. Flour and baking powder: Sift the flour and baking powder together, then gradually add them to the egg mixture. Continue to gently mix to incorporate the ingredients without forming lumps.
5. Preparing the pan: Grease a baking pan with oil and dust it with flour, ensuring it is evenly covered. This step will prevent the base from sticking.
6. Baking: Pour the base mixture into the pan and level the surface. Place the pan in a preheated oven at 180°C and bake for 25-30 minutes, or until the base is well risen and golden. Check if it is baked using a toothpick; if it comes out clean, the base is ready.
Preparing the Cream
1. Boiling the milk: In a saucepan, bring the milk to a boil together with 4 tablespoons of sugar. Stir occasionally to prevent sticking.
2. Adding the pudding: When the milk starts to boil, add the caramel pudding. Continue stirring until the mixture becomes thick and homogeneous. Then, remove the saucepan from the heat and let it cool. It is important to stir occasionally to avoid lumps.
3. Preparing the cream: Once the pudding has cooled, take the margarine (Rama) and beat it well with a mixer until creamy. Add one tablespoon of the cooled pudding, mixing at low speed to prevent the cream from curdling. Continue until all the pudding is incorporated.
4. Adding the walnuts: Finally, add the ground walnuts to the cream, gently mixing to achieve a fine and delicious texture.
Assembling the Cake
1. Cooling the base: After baking, remove the base from the oven and let it cool completely in the pan. Then, cut it into two equal halves horizontally.
2. Filling: Place the first half of the base on a platter and spread the cream evenly. Cover with the second half of the base.
3. Decorating: Melt the chocolate in a double boiler or in the microwave, being careful not to burn it. Pour the melted chocolate over the cake and let it cool so that the chocolate hardens.
Serving and Suggestions
Lary cake can be served plain, but you can accompany it with caramel sauce or vanilla ice cream for a delicious contrast. You can also add fresh fruits like strawberries or raspberries, which will add a touch of freshness.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. Can I use a different type of margarine?
Yes, you can also use butter, but you will need to adjust the quantity since butter has a higher fat content.
2. How can I make the cake less sweet?
You can reduce the amount of sugar in the base and the cream. You can also use dark chocolate for decoration.
3. What is the best way to store it?
The cake is best stored in the refrigerator, covered with plastic wrap, to maintain its freshness.
4. Can I replace the nuts?
Yes, you can omit the nuts or replace them with ground hazelnuts or almonds, depending on your preferences.
